Crashing in three of the last four grands prix weekends, Carlos Sainz says they all had nothing in common with “three separate causes”.

Sainz was in the barrier at the Hungarian Grand Prix, losing the rear end of his SF21 into the final turn during qualifying, sending him into the barriers with a whack.

Two race weekends later, at the Dutch Grand Prix, he again lost the rear of the car, crashing into the top barrier at the banked Turn 3 during practice.

A week later he was nose-first into the barrier at the Monza circuit, again during practice, having lost control through the middle part of the Ascari chicane.
